Completion of Linearly Ordered Groups

We give examples of linearly ordered groups that are not embeddable in divisible orderable. In the first example, the group does not embed in any divisible group with strictly isolated unity. In the second example, the group in question is an $O^*$-group, and in the third, it is a group with a central system of convex subgroups.
